In gaming workloads, the Core i7-12700K delivers approximately +8% higher frame rates compared to the Core i5-13400. For budget-conscious buyers, the Core i5-13400 currently offers better value, available at a $171 price difference.

Core i7-12700K Advantages

Up to 8% faster in gaming benchmarks on average – 165 vs 153 FPS

More processing cores – 12 vs 10 cores

Core i5-13400 Advantages

Up to 81% better value for money – $1.17 vs $2.12/FPS

Costs only 51% of the price – $180 vs $350 (49% cheaper)

Consumes up to 48% less energy – 65W vs 125W
